The £8 million available for the first phase of the restoration is sufficient to carry out the necessary structural repairs; provide public access to the building and permit public use for concerts, theatre, conferences, exhibitions and so on.

However, the funds currently available will not be sufficient to restore the Royal Hall to its full former glory, and the Royal Hall Restoration Trust has been formed to help finance those additional elements that are needed to return the building to its original Matcham magnificence.

In particular, the Trust plans to fund the following items:

  • full restoration of the decor in the main auditorium and the ambulatory
  • full refurbishment of the dressing rooms
  • refurbishment of the entrance steps complete with disabled access
  • installation of an interpretative heritage trail throughout the building
  • restoration of period seating and soft furnishings
  • restoration of a period bar
